Small town gets delicious creamery!! Our town is so fortunate to have the Green Cow Creamery. The owner is a former educator turned ice cream shop owner. He is making all the flavored ice creams from scratch using high quality ingredients. The Red Velvet and Chocolate flavors are delicious, but I prefer non- dairy, so I am thrilled to brag on the Strawberry/coconut and the Orange Dream (also coconut based). They are my go-to decadent flavors. The shop has the vintage soda shop vibe and is decorated with an enormous green cow, because the town's football colors are green/white. The coolest thing is that the creamery gives back to the town's schools with contests. Whether you just walk in for a cone, pint, or want to book the shop for a child's ice cream-making birthday party, the Green Cow will give you all the fond memories and keep you coming back for more.
